Burberry’s Recent Price Target Adjustment

Burberry (BURBY) is experiencing a significant shift in market sentiment as Telsey Advisory has recently adjusted its price target. The new target has been lowered from 13 GBp to 11 GBp, reflecting the firm’s cautious stance on the luxury brand’s future performance.
